On February 23, Beijing time, the 2021-22 NBA regular season ushered in the All-Star Weekend holiday. Earlier today, the Nets officially announced they signed guard Dragic. According to previous reports, in order to sign Dragic, the Nets cut Jevon Carter.

According to a prominent ESPN reporter, Jevon Carter will sign a contract with the Bucks. He noted that Carter has averaged 12 minutes per game for the Nets this season and that he will increase the Bucks' guard bench depth. Carter, 26, played for the Grizzlies and Then the Suns, and in the 2018 draft, the Grizzlies selected him with the second overall pick in the second round.

So far this season, Carter has averaged 12 minutes per game, averaging 3.6 points, 1.5 rebounds and 1 assist, shooting 33.3% from the field and 33.1% from three-point range!

It should be noted that after the recent big deal between the Nets and the 76ers, in order to free up a place, the Nets cut Bemburi, and then Bemburi quickly completed the contract with the Bucks. If the Bucks then sign with Carter, they will sign two nets veterans in a row.

For Carter and Bembry, moving from the Nets to the Bucks didn't reduce the odds of winning the title. Last season, the Bucks eliminated the Nets to advance to the Eastern Conference Finals and win the championship. Leaving Durant and Irving, they will join hands with Alphabet Brother to launch an assault on the championship.

So far, the Bucks are 5th in the East with a record of 36 wins and 24 losses, and the Nets are 8th with 31 wins and 28 losses.
